General covariant transformations
ID: general-covariant-transformations
General covariant transformations are a key concept in the field of differential geometry and theoretical physics, particularly in the contexts of general relativity and other theories that utilize a geometric framework for describing physical phenomena. In essence, a general covariant transformation is a transformation that applies to fields and geometric objects defined on a manifold, allowing them to change in a way that is consistent with the structure of that manifold.
